Incode supports different digital identity schemes in Asia. To enable methods for a flow, go to ID Capture Module → Digital IDs in the Dashboard.

Contact your Incode Representative to enable support for specific countries.


Available methods


MethodSDK IDCountry
SingpasssingpassSingapore (SG)
DigiLockerdigilockerIndia (IN)
UAE Passuae_passUnited Arab Emirates (AE)

Available attributes by method

All attributes are returned via GET /omni/get/ocr-data/v2 under the ocrData object. Two fields identify the credential:

  • documentSubmissionMethod — always IMPORTED_CREDENTIAL for digital ID sessions
  • credentialsProvider — identifies the specific scheme (e.g. uae_pass)

Singpass — Singapore

AttributeocrData field
Family namename.paternalLastName
Full namename.fullName
Date of birthbirthDate
Nationalitynationality
Gendergender
Phone numberphone
StreetaddressFields.street
Postal codeaddressFields.postalCode
CountryissuingCountry
Document typetypeOfId
Document numberdocumentNumber
Expiry dateexpireAt

DigiLocker — India

AttributeocrData field
Given namename.givenName
Family namename.paternalLastName
Date of birthbirthDate
Gendergender
Full addressaddress
Aadhaar number (masked)documentNumber
Portrait photovia /omni/get/images

UAE Pass — United Arab Emirates

AttributeocrData field
Given namename.givenName
Family namename.paternalLastName
Date of birthbirthDate
Emirates ID numberdocumentNumber
Expiry dateexpireAt
Portrait photovia /omni/get/images